I'm porting linux to a development platform with its VIA Southbridge connected to the secondary bus of a PCI bridge.

I've made the following quick hacks to get as far as I have but would now like to get some pointers as to the "right way".

1. The 4k IO space window for the bridge setup isn't enough for all the VIA IO memory space so I've bumped this up to 64K.

2. Because the VIA is on the "wrong side of the bridge" the isa_io_base has effectively been changed to 0xfebf0000.
Again I've made a quick hack to my platform setup.c to reflect this and the kernel now Oops's as per the included debug
capture.


If anyone could give me some pointers as to the right way to approach this I would be most obliged ? Is there any way to
   "pin" the VIA to a known address ( 0xfe000000 ) as adding devices onto my primary PCI bus will change the
isa_io_base. Also are there any known issues with PCI-PCI bridging and ppc etc ...
